Output 69e7279ec586eda0788bfdfbfca302526ce483f7927d65ce105fec32cef0db27:2

value
37489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53e1a20dea972b50292d54910c952aefc6ff375b OP_EQUALVERIFY OP_CHECKSIG
address
18eXPBQGpdcHzn9zovCttLAuvweowVC7PX
transaction
69e7279ec586eda0788bfdfbfca302526ce483f7927d65ce105fec32cef0db27
spent
true